NEWS: add old entry about Type=ether
Apparently it's an important feature for some folks:
https://utcc.utoronto.ca/\~cks/space/blog/linux/NetworkdMACMatchesWidely.
I think we considered this more of a bugfix, but it's somewhere on the border.
Let's add this it's easier to discover.

@@ -1934,6 +1934,11 @@ CHANGES WITH 245: for the [RoutingPolicyRule] section of .network files to configure source routing based on UID ranges and prefix length, respectively. + * The Type= match property of .link files has been generalized to + always match the device type shown by 'networkctl status', even for + devices where udev does not set DEVTYPE=. This allows e.g. Type=ether + to be used. + * sd-bus gained a new API call sd_bus_message_sensitive() that marks a D-Bus message object as "sensitive".
